The economy is booming and the city has spent hundreds of millions of dollars to combat homelessness. It still went up 16%




The stunning increase in homelessness announced in Los Angeles this week — up 16% over last year citywide — was an almost incomprehensible conundrum given the nation's booming economy and the hundreds of millions of dollars that city, county and state officials have directed toward the problem.
